Bully Pulpit International is an outcomes agency made up of strategists, data scientists, and artists. We come from politics, brands, and government and we communicate without barriers and measure what matters. We have more than 350 team members in six countries and thirteen offices - Berlin, Brussels, Chicago, D.C., London, Los Angeles, New York, Oslo, San Francisco, and Zürich. We apply our unique expertise across strategic communications, public affairs, research, and digital marketing to create sophisticated and customized strategies that make change possible for both American and European clients.

The Impact You Will Make
The Director/Senior Director serves as the primary bridge between agency leadership and client success. You will act as a client lead directly owning the relationship and overseeing the lifecycle of an account from the initial new business pitch to final reporting. This role requires a hybrid skill set: the political savvy of a lobbyist, the creative flair of an ad executive, and the precision of a project manager.
You are a "player-coach" who is just as comfortable in a pitch meeting with a CEO as you are in redlining a press release or managing a complex editorial calendar. You thrive in ambiguous environments and are able to quickly understand what the client needs and translate it into a clear strategy that teams can operationalize. You don't just wait for news to happen; you monitor client issue areas to proactively flag opportunities for engagement before the client even realizes they exist.
What Day to Day Looks Like
- Strategic Account Leadership
- Executive Liaison: Serve as the primary point of contact for senior-level decision-makers, offering real-time strategic counsel with minimal oversight.
- Campaign Architecture: Set the strategy for and oversee the execution of earned and owned media campaigns, ensuring they align with the client's long-term goals.
- Integrated Execution: Shepherd projects across multi-disciplinary service teams, including media planning, media buying, creative, measurement, and data insights.
- Content & Media Excellence
- High-Stakes Writing: Oversee the production of everything from high-level strategic memos and communications plans to tactical press releases, op-eds, and social media content.
- Media Relations: Proactively develop earned media strategies, leveraging existing reporter relationships to place stories that move the needle on key issues.
- Team Management & Mentorship
- Workflow Oversight: Manage internal teams across different offices to ensure quality control and adherence to tight deadlines.
- Professional Development: Act as a coach and/or direct manager for junior staff, providing clear feedback and supporting their professional development.
- Business Development
- Growth Strategy: Partner with agency leadership to identify, draft, and present proposals for new business opportunities.
- Relationship Building: Expand existing accounts while establishing trust with prospective clients through compelling pitch decks and presentations.
